Sainsbury's , 385 Dunchurch Road, RUGBY, CV22 6HU

Granted Rugby R08/0424/VARI Legacy

Works: Extension

Permission granted. Work must normally begin within three years of the decision or the permission lapses.

Proposal

Variation of Condition 5 of planning permission reference R87/0535/18368/OP dated 23/06/87 and deletion of Condition 7 of planning permission reference R99/0386/18368/OP dated 25/07/2000 to allow redistribution of retail areas within the store and extension of product range.
